Output 31c64b520ef8c8cc4b2d7c7f2eddc659fae917dee82881ca8f7e6b60febec786:1

value
126491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18cb30466646f4fa620dbb0f165bd374d335147c OP_EQUAL
address
33x7YwKQLspNZueMwRkzCrXgyrueBwtgv6
transaction
31c64b520ef8c8cc4b2d7c7f2eddc659fae917dee82881ca8f7e6b60febec786
confirmations
263891
spent
true